Output 9efcccddfd56f144ebee1e7b2821f59d61da88fae087af0bd97b8a52182dcf3f:1

value
266000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fb392307390c2feb13cd29c6150cd7a5d4c573f OP_EQUAL
address
3AR3Eamf21PGvMQyemRf5NbWthabyAMkKG
transaction
9efcccddfd56f144ebee1e7b2821f59d61da88fae087af0bd97b8a52182dcf3f
confirmations
348769
spent
true